These 5 simple habits make my PC feel much faster
Windows PCs can feel slow over time, often due to neglect and poor usage habits rather than hardware limitations. Simple changes to workflow, such as regular reboots and properly terminating applications, can significantly improve performance. These habits are easy to implement and can make a noticeable difference, even on older machines.
